I am trying to get a RHEL4 box to LDAP authenticate against FDS (also on RHEL4) and failing…..

In the logs (messages) I have,

Sep 10 13:30:52 vuwunicvfwall02 sshd(pam_unix)[2284]: authentication failure; logname= uid=0 euid=0 tty=ssh ruser= rhost=vuwunicvadmin02.res.vuw.ac.nz user=jonesst1

Sep 10 13:30:52 vuwunicvfwall02 sshd[2284]: pam_ldap: ldap_simple_bind Can't contact LDAP server

Sep 10 13:30:52 vuwunicvfwall02 sshd[2284]: pam_ldap: ldap_simple_bind Can't contact LDAP server

Sep 10 13:31:05 vuwunicvfwall02 sshd(pam_unix)[2284]: 2 more authentication failures; logname= uid=0 euid=0 tty=ssh ruser= rhost=vuwunicvadmin02.res.vuw.ac.nz user=jonesst1

Any ideas why? And how to fix? Also is there a way to search the archive for this list?

Have you seen this: http://directory.fedoraproject.org/wiki/Howto:PAM - search for ssh

When I do a,

ldapsearch -x -h 130.195.87.249 -b dc=vuw,dc=ac,dc=nz "(ou=Users)"

The server replies so FDS appears to be running OK….
